Longtime Restaurant Owner
Dies At Age 74
Services for Toney Angelos, owner of the Jefferson Cafe at 71 North Third for many years, who died about 11 Monday night at St. Joseph Hospital, will be at 2:30 p.m. today at the Greek Orthodox Church of the Annunciation. Burial will be in Point Church Cemetery.
Mr. Angelos, who was 74, had been in the restaurant business since he came Memphis from Greece about 55 years ago.
Mr. Angelos bought his own restaurant many years ago and operated it with his wife, Mrs. Myrtie Lou Angelos. He was a member of the Greek Orthodox Church. Mr. Angelos lived at 1308 Tutwiler.
He also leaves two sisters, Mrs. Lambro Limberi and Mrs. Demetra Hafani, both of Greece.
The Commercial Appeal
May 12, 1965
